#101382 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#101382 is composed of 6.3% red, 7.5%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.7% cyan, 85.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 238.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 28.6%. #101382 color hex could be obtained by blending #2026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

Shades and Tints of #101382

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010108 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#101382

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#48484a is the less saturated color, while #05088d is the most saturated one.
